Mrs. Aisha Kareem was overwhelmed with joy glaring all over her face, when the team led by Mr. Gregory Azemobor – the convener of Voice of Divine Truth International Outreach A.K.A Voice of Change, paid her a surprise visit today during our outreach. Mrs. Aisha Kareem, a 48 years old widow who resides at NO. 38 Felicia Oke Street in Olawora Lagos state with her four children lost her husband since 2000 after an undisclosed brief illness. She is a petty trader who sells vegetables, fresh tomatoes and peppers in front of her house.

Narrating her story, she says;
I started this petty business after I lost my husband some years ago. My husband died in 2000 following an undisclosed brief illness. Since my husband’s death, I have been struggling to survive; to eat, feed, train my four children and pay house rent. I have no one to help me; even my husband’s family deserted me. But with God, I have been managing with this little business.

The team decided to diminish her grief by giving her a cash donation of ₦20,000 to support her petty business. Feeling so excited, Mrs. Aisha Kareem expressed her gratitude to the Voice of Divine Truth Int’l Outreach team and used the opportunity to advise other widows to find something doing and not stay idle.
